Fig. 6.
Cdk5 phosphorylation of the serine 1144 of rat synaptojanin 1 affects its interaction with endophilin and amphiphysin. (A) Serine 1144 and/or threonine 1147 were mutated to alanine, and GST fusions of the wild-type and mutant PRDs were incubated with p35/Cdk5 and [32P]ATP. Incubation mixtures were then analyzed by SDS/PAGE followed by Coomassie blue (CB) staining and autoradiography. (B) GST fusion proteins of the wild-type PRD of synaptojanin 1, or of two mutants harboring a S → A or S → D mutation at position 1144, were used in pull-down assays from rat brain cytosol. Western blotting of the bound material revealed that the “phosphomimetic mutation” (S1144D) inhibited the recovery of both amphiphysin 1 and endophilin 1 in the bound material.
